Flow-actuated unloaders divert water to bypass when there is a sufficient drop or stoppage of water flow into the unloader. Trapped pressure unloaders are opened by the increase in pressure when the trigger is released on the gun. The trigger shuts off the water flow, causing the unloader valve to re-circulate the water back to the header tank or alternatively back to the inlet side of the pump. The trigger on the gun and unloader valve together make up a two-part valve that directs water into the bypass of the unloader and then back in to the water inlet side of the pump or alternatively back to a header tank. The unloader valve can also be used for adjusting the pressure of your machine. The Unloader valve is designed to respond to an increase in pressure or a change in water flow. A pressure washer unloader valve diverts the water flow through the bypass when the trigger on the gun is depressed.
